Position Summary

This position is responsible for processing raw materials and/or kit and delivery of parts to work areas or processing orders ready for shipment.

Delivery

Skills, Abilities and Mastery (Responsibility Matrix):

  • Receive and verify the quality and quantity of shipments of incoming materials.
  • Build packaging, pack, check product quality, weigh, organize and verify paperwork of shipments.
  • Monitor key materials performance metrics such as cycle count, inventory turns, and safety.
  • Plan and coordinate physical movement of materials, parts, finished goods, and information to ensure optimization of cost and service level.
  • Issues and delivers correct materials to production floor, keeps track of inventory, and ships and receives material to ensure proper flow.
  • Loads and unloads material within a warehouse or storage facility.
  • Utilizes hand trucks, forklifts, hoists, or other handling equipment to move material to and from locations and transportation vehicles within the facility.
  • Delivers continuous improvement through participation in lean kaizen events.
  • Problem solves and implements controls for cycle count discrepancies
